'Outback Flying Doctor Phemie Grainger prides herself on being cool, calm and capable–until a chance encounter with her professional idol, renowned emergency doctor Gil Fitzwilliam, throws her into turmoil! As a Down'€™s Syndrome carrier, Phemie's always known that her dreams of love, marriage and children are impossible. But as she starts falling for Gil'€™s English charm, the sweetness of his kisses, even the sadness she sees in his eyes, Phemie can'€™t help wondering if, with Gil at her side, her dreams of holding her very own baby might one day come true.'

Source: Publisher's blurb.
